| dc.description | Let R=k[x_1,...,x_d] be the polynomial ring in d independent variables, where k is a field of characteristic p>0. Let D be the ring of k-linear differential operators of R and let f be a polynomial in R. In this work we prove that the localization R[1/f] obtained from R by inverting f is generated as a D-module by 1/f. This is an amazing fact considering that the corresponding characteristic zero statement is very false. | |
